What is the percentage required in 12th board exam for integrated LLB course and which entrance exams to attempt?


What is the percentage required for in 12th board exam for pursuing integrated BA and LLB course after 12th? Is there any entrance exam for taking admission in this course? If yes, then please provide the details of those exams.

B.A LLB is an integrated five year duration course.

The required qualification to get admission in the course is that :

Candidate must have passed 12th from a recognised board.

Candidate must have scored minimum 45% in 12th ( but it varies with institutes ).

CLAT examination is conducted for admission in National Law universities and various universities conducts entrance test for admission.

So, for detail regarding a specific university or institute visit at the official website.

B.A LLB is an integrated course. It is of five year duration.

The required aggregate to appear for examination varies with examination. The eligibility to appear for entrance examination is that candidate must have passed 12th from a recognised board.

There is no age limit to appear for examination. Some of the entrance examination are CLAT, BHU LAT etc.

As far as you are concerned about the minimum marks required in Class 12th for getting admission in integrated LLB ( Bachelor of legislative law ) course then it varies with university as in case of NLUs the minimum marks required is 45% while for admission in universities DU, BHU, etc. the minimum marks required in Class 12th is 50%. Further, the marks relaxation is allowed for reserved category candidates as per the university rules.

Also, for getting admission in top law universities for pursuing integrated LLB course you need to qualify entrance examinations such as CLAT ( Common Law Admission Test ), DU LLB entrance examination, BHU UET, CUCET, etc. and for details and updates regarding these examinations you can refer to their respective official links.
